采用ARM控制器的制動性能測試儀設(shè)計
摘要:制動性能測試儀是一種以測量機(jī)車充分發(fā)出的平均減速度來檢驗機(jī)車制動性能,同時具有其它輔助項目的綜合性測試儀器。新一代制動性能測試儀的硬件采用ARM控制器,SD存儲卡,USB通信接口以及觸摸式人機(jī)界面,軟件采用基于μC/OS-II的面向任務(wù)的設(shè)計方法。實際測試表明,新儀表的性能指標(biāo)達(dá)到設(shè)計要求。本文系統(tǒng)地介紹了該儀器的測量原理、硬件設(shè)計和軟件設(shè)計。
本文引用地址:http://2s4d.com/article/147857.htm引言
《機(jī)動車行車安全技術(shù)條件》[1]GB7258-2012中規(guī)定了行車制動性能檢驗的若干種方法,其中包括用制動距離檢驗行車制動性能、用充分發(fā)出的平均減速度檢驗行車制動性能等,制動性能測試儀正是根據(jù)這些測試要求開發(fā)出來的一種儀器。除了上述制動性能測試功能外,儀表同時還具有測量加速性能、踏板力、路面坡度以及車速表校驗等功能。
此次研發(fā)的新一代制動性能測試儀采用ARM單片機(jī)作為主控制器,SD卡作為存儲媒介,人機(jī)界面采用觸摸式液晶屏,增加了與GPS模塊和電腦通信的USB接口,軟件使用了基于μC/OS-II的面向任務(wù)的設(shè)計方法。新的硬件及軟件的應(yīng)用使儀表性能在原有基礎(chǔ)上得到了大幅提升。
測量原理
由基本物理量的關(guān)系可知,對加速度進(jìn)行積分計算可以得到速度:
對速度進(jìn)行積分計算可以得到距離:
有了速度和距離,根據(jù)《機(jī)動車行車安全技術(shù)條件》[1]GB7258-2012中關(guān)于MFDD的定義就可計算得到機(jī)車充分發(fā)出的平均減速度:
式中:MFDD——充分發(fā)出的平均減速度,單位為米每平方秒(m/s2);
由上分析可知測量MFDD的關(guān)鍵是測量加速度。測量原理如圖1所示,首先由加速度傳感器把加速度轉(zhuǎn)換為電信號,然后經(jīng)過放大電路放大輸入A/D轉(zhuǎn)換器,A/D轉(zhuǎn)換器把模擬量轉(zhuǎn)換為數(shù)字量,再由單片機(jī)對采集的數(shù)據(jù)進(jìn)行積分計算得到速度、距離和MFDD。
加速度傳感器采用的是硅微電容式固態(tài)加速度傳感器。其內(nèi)部有一個對加速度敏感的質(zhì)量塊,這個質(zhì)量塊通過具有彈性的懸臂固定在敏感器殼體上,質(zhì)量塊的上方和下方分別設(shè)置一個電極板,它們與質(zhì)量塊相隔一個很窄的相等的間隙,這兩個極板分別與質(zhì)量塊形成一個相等的電容,當(dāng)殼體在沿著這個質(zhì)量塊的上下方向發(fā)生加速度時,慣性力使質(zhì)量塊產(chǎn)生位移,改變了間隙,因而電容量發(fā)生變化。這兩個電容量的差值與加速度成正比,這就構(gòu)成了電容式加速度傳感器[2]。其結(jié)構(gòu)圖如圖2所示。
制動性能測試儀還可對踏板力進(jìn)行測量,其原理與加速度測量基本相同,首先由力傳感器把踏板力轉(zhuǎn)換為電信號,然后經(jīng)過放大電路放大輸入A/D轉(zhuǎn)換器,最后計算得到踏板力值。
踏板力測量使用的是輪輻式應(yīng)變傳感器,傳感器以金屬彈性體變形原理和電阻應(yīng)變片的應(yīng)變原理為基礎(chǔ),傳感器結(jié)構(gòu)如圖3所示。電阻應(yīng)變片被熱固性樹脂粘結(jié)劑牢固地粘貼在踏板力彈性體應(yīng)變區(qū)表面,四片電阻應(yīng)變片連接成惠斯登電橋線路,如圖4所示。在外力作用下,電阻應(yīng)變片隨踏板力傳感器彈性體變形而改變電阻值,其中R1、R3的電阻變化方向和R2、R4相反,這樣就使應(yīng)變電橋產(chǎn)生一個與外力成正比的電壓輸出信號[2]。
評論